
652
Chapter 16
FCAN Controller
User’s Manual U16702EE3V2UD00
16.15 Baud Rate Settings
16.15.1 Bit rate setting conditions
Make sure that the settings are within the range of limit values for ensuring correct operation of the CAN
controller, as follows.
(a) 5TQ
≤
SPT (sampling point)
≤
17 TQ
SPT = TSEG1 + 1
(b) 8 TQ
≤
DBT (data bit time)
≤
25 TQ
DBT = TSEG1 + TSEG2 + 1TQ = TSEG2 + SPT
(c) 1 TQ
≤
SJW (synchronization jump width)
≤
4TQ
SJW
≤
DBT – SPT
(d) 4
≤
TSEG1
≤
16 [3
≤
Setting value of TSEG1[3:0]
≤
15]
(e) 1
≤
TSEG2
≤
8 [0
≤
Setting value of TSEG2[2:0]
≤
7]
Remark:
TQ = 1/f
TQ
(f
TQ
: CAN protocol layer basic system clock)
TSEG1[3:0] (Bits 3 to 0 of CANn bit rate register (CnBTR))
TSEG2[2:0] (Bits 10 to 8 of CANn bit rate register (CnBTR))
electronic components distributor